Primary Purpose:

Provide speech-language pathology services to students under the supervision of a licensed Speech-Language Pathologist in accordance with Texas Department of Licensing and Regulation (TDLR) requirements. 

Qualifications:

Education/Certification:

Bachelor’s degree in communication sciences and disorders or related field

Valid Texas Speech-Language Pathology Assistant license issued by TDLR

 

Special Knowledge/Skills:

Strong communication, organizational, and interpersonal skills

Knowledge of speech-language disorders and conditions

 

Experience:

Fifty hours of clinical observation and assisting experience as required for licensure

Major Responsibilities and Duties:

Therapy

  1. Assist with speech and language screenings as directed by the supervising licensed speech-language pathologist. 
  2. Implement the treatment program or the individual education plan (IEP) as designed by the supervising licensed speech-language pathologist.
  3. Conduct carry-over activities to transfer a student’s newly acquired communication ability to other contexts and situations.
  4. Participate in ARD committee meetings as directed by the supervising licensed speech-language pathologist. 
  5. Conduct observations and prepare clinical materials.
  6. Collect and document student performance data for progress monitoring purposes. 
  7. Prepare therapy materials and assist in maintaining therapy resources and equipment. 
  8. Assist with documentation requirements related to Medicaid/SHARS billing in accordance with district procedures. 

Consultation

  1. Work with classroom teachers to implement classroom activities to improve communication skills of students.

Student Management

  1. Create an environment conducive to learning and appropriate for maturity level and interests of students.
  2. Assist in maintaining appropriate student behavior and a positive learning environment. 

Program Management

  1. Compile, maintain, and file all reports, records, and other documents required including maintaining clinical records in accordance with federal and state laws and regulations.
  2. Comply with policies established by federal and state laws, State Board of Education rule, and board policies. Comply with all district and campus routines and regulations.
  3. Perform duties only as assigned and supervised by a licensed speech-language pathologist in accordance with state licensure rules. 

Supervisory Responsibilities:

None.

Mental Demands/Physical Demands/Environmental Factors:

Tools/Equipment Used: Standard testing equipment; standard office equipment including computer and peripherals

Posture: Frequent sitting, kneeling/squatting, bending/stooping, pushing/pulling, and twisting

Motion: Frequent walking, grasping/squeezing, wrist flexion/extension

Lifting: Regular light lifting and carrying (under 15 pounds), occasional heavy lifting (45 pounds or more) and positioning of students with physical disabilities; controlling behavior through physical restraint; assisting nonambulatory students

Environment: Exposure to biological hazards, bacteria, and communicable diseases; may require districtwide travel

Mental Demands: Work with frequent interruptions; maintain emotional control under pressure
